Financial Management and Cost Control

Cost overruns are a major challenge in construction. NetSuite for construction provides advanced financial management features to ensure budgets remain accurate and up to date. It connects project expenses, payroll, subcontractor payments, and material purchases into one platform. Automating billing, accounts payable, and accounts receivable reduces errors and accelerates cash flow. With built-in dashboards, CFOs and financial controllers can monitor profitability in real time. The ability to drill down into costs by project, phase, or department allows firms to identify inefficiencies early and take corrective action.

Multi-Subsidiary and Global Capabilities

Large construction firms often operate across regions or even internationally. NetSuite for construction is designed to handle multi-subsidiary, multi-currency, and multi-language operations. This allows for standardized processes across all subsidiaries while maintaining compliance with local laws. Consolidated reporting makes it easier for executives to gain a global view of performance while still drilling down into local operations. For growing firms, this capability ensures scalability without compromising efficiency.
